Identifying Genuine Irradiation Cross-linked Low Smoke Zero Halogen Flame-Retardant Wire and Cable

2024-12-20 15:21:19 ChinaCable

Irradiation is a processing method.

Low smoke zero halogen is a material characteristic.

Irradiation is generally a processing process that turns polyethylene material into cross-linked polyethylene.

It is a physical method that is energy-saving, environmentally friendly, efficient, and has good controllability. Low smoke zero halogen materials meet certain indicators. Low smoke zero halogen cables should meet the requirements specified in GB/T 19666-2019.

A large number of counterfeit irradiation cross-linked low smoke zero halogen flame-retardant wires and cables exist in the market.

Here are four simple methods to identify irradiation cross-linked low smoke zero halogen flame-retardant wires and cables:

1. Product Name Identification Method

For wires - Irradiation cross-linked low smoke zero halogen flame-retardant polyethylene insulated wire and cable; for cables - Irradiation cross-linked low smoke zero halogen flame-retardant polyethylene insulated low smoke zero halogen flame-retardant polyethylene sheathed power cable. Counterfeits usually have slightly different names, such as irradiation cross-linked polyethylene insulated low smoke zero halogen sheathed flame-retardant power cable and so on.

2. Surface Burning Method

Use an electric soldering iron to burn the insulation layer. There should be no obvious depression. If there is a large depression, it indicates that there are defects in the material or process used for the insulation layer. Or use a lighter to barbecue. Under normal circumstances, it should not be easily ignited. After a long time of burning, the insulation layer of the cable is still relatively complete, without thick smoke and pungent odor, and the diameter increases. If it is very easy to ignite, it can be determined that the insulation layer of the cable does not use low smoke zero halogen material (most likely polyethylene or cross-linked polyethylene material). If there is a large amount of smoke, it indicates that the insulation layer uses halogen-containing material. If after a long time of burning, the insulation surface peels off seriously and the diameter does not increase significantly, it indicates that proper irradiation cross-linking process treatment has not been carried out.

3. Hot Water Immersion Method

Put the wire core or cable in 90°C hot water. Under normal circumstances, the insulation resistance will not drop rapidly and remain above 0.1 MΩ/Km. If the insulation resistance drops rapidly and even falls below 0.009 MΩ/Km, it indicates that proper irradiation cross-linking process treatment has not been carried out. (This method is not applicable for identifying polyethylene or cross-linked polyethylene insulating materials. The second method above can be used for identification).

4. Density Comparison Method

Low smoke zero halogen materials have a density greater than that of water. You can peel off a little insulation layer and put it in water. If it floats above the water surface, it is definitely not a low smoke zero halogen material.
